18-2 简简短短的的条条目目

该博客介绍了如何修改Django模型的__str__()方法,以便在条目文本长度超过50字符时才显示省略号。通过添加if语句,确保短于50字符的条目在管理网站或shell中不会显示省略号。用户被鼓励创建一个长度小于50字符的条目以验证改动效果。
摘要由CSDN通过智能技术生成

def __str__(self):

"""返回模型的字符串表示"""

if len(self.text)>50:   #如果字符串大于50

return self.text[:50]+"..."   #就显示前50加上省略号

else:

return self.text

 

#18-2 简简短短的的条条目目

#

#18-2 简短的条目 :当前,Django在管理网站或shell中显示Entry 实例时,模型Entry 的方法__str__() 都在它的末尾加上省略号。请在方法__str__()

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值